Access Guide
Overview
-
About
View
- Nexus is a large building with 4 floors.
- The building has 3 lifts.
- The building has 3 staircases.
- The building floors are signed as: 0, 1, 2 and 3.

Parking and Public Transport
View
- The building has its own car park, with Blue Badge parking available.
- The building also has a campus car park nearby.
- The nearest train station is Hatfield.
- This station has step-free access.

Getting Inside
- The approach to the building is step-free and level.
- The most accessible entrance surveyed was the only entrance.
- This entrance gives access to floor 0.
- There is step-free level access at the most accessible entrance.
Getting Around
-
Access
View
- There is step-free access between floors via lift.
- There is step-free level access throughout walkways.
-
Circulation
View
- There are manual doors along circulation routes.
- There is a low colour contrast between the walls and floor along most circulation routes.
- The flooring is shiny.
- There is no (or very little) background noise.
- Wayfinding signage is provided.
- The colour, design and typeface of signage is consistent throughout.
- Seating available in the walkways includes: chairs with armrests and sofas.
- Lighting levels vary due to the use of large glazed walls.
Toilet and Changing Facilities
-
Toilet Facilities
View
- There are 5 toilets with adaptations.
- The toilets with adaptations are located to the rear of the building on floor 0 and along the corridor towards the right of the building on all floors.
- The transfer space varies between toilets with adaptations.
- Ambulant toilet facilities are located in the male and female standard toilets along the corridor towards the right of the building on all floors.
- Female and male step-free standard toilet facilities are located along the corridor towards the right of the building on all floors.

Parking (Building Blue Badge Bays)
-
Car Park
View
- The car park is located to the west of the building.
- The car park is open air/surface.
- The car park surface consists of block paving.
- There are 4 designated Blue Badge parking bays available.
- The Blue Badge bays are clearly marked and signposted.
- The surveyed Blue Badge parking bay dimensions are 240cm (width) x 540cm (depth).
- There are no hatched/marked zones.
- The most accessible route from the Blue Badge parking has step-free level access.
- This route has bollards.
-
Charges and Restrictions
View
- Parking is free for all users.
-
Drop-off Point
View
- There is not a designated drop-off point available.

Entrance
- This entrance is located at the front of the building.
- The approach to the entrance has uneven surfaces and bollards.
- The entrance area is clearly signed.
- There is a canopy or recess which provides weather protection at the entrance.
- There is step-free level access at the entrance.
- There are double automatic doors.
- The doors open by sliding.
- The width of the opening is 107cm.
- The doors have a high colour contrast.
Reception
-
Location
View
- The reception is located next to the entrance as you enter the building.
- The distance from the entrance is 10m.
-
Route
View
- The most accessible route to the reception has step-free level access.
- There are no doors to open along the most accessible route.
-
Access
View
- There is step-free level access to the reception.
- The height of the reception desk is 105cm.
- There is not a lowered section at the desk.
- There is not a hearing assistance system.
- There is no (or very little) background noise in this area.
- The flooring is shiny.
- Lighting levels vary due to the use of large glazed walls.
- There is some room for a wheelchair user to manoeuvre in the seating area (150cm x 150cm).
- There is space for an assistance dog to rest in the seating area.
- Seating available in this area includes: chairs with armrests.
- Furniture available in this area includes: coffee tables.
Lift
- The lift surveyed is located to your right on entrance into the building.
- The distance from the entrance is 20m.
- The most accessible route to the lift has step-free level access.
- There are no doors to open along the most accessible route.
-
Standard Lift
View
- The floors 0, 1, 2 and 3 can be accessed by this lift.
- The lift door has a high colour contrast.
- The lift has a level manoeuvring space in front of it for a wheelchair user (150cm x 150cm).
- The weight limit for the lift is 1000kg.
- The external lift control buttons have tactile and Braille markings.
- The control buttons have a high colour contrast.
- All of the external lift controls are at a suitable height for a wheelchair user.
- The lift door opening width is 100cm.
- The internal dimensions of the lift are 145cm (width) x 152cm (depth).
- The internal lift control buttons have tactile and Braille markings.
- The control buttons have a high colour contrast.
- Some of the internal lift controls are at a suitable height for a wheelchair user.
- Internally the lift has: a visual floor indicator, an audible announcer, an intercom hearing assistance system and a mirror to aid reversing.
- Lighting levels were even at the time of the survey, with unshaded light sources.
- There are other lifts available at this location which are of a similar size.
- There is an additional larger lift located towards the right of the building.
Stairs
- The stairs are located in the entrance foyer.
- The floors 0, 1, 2 and 3 can be accessed by these stairs.
- There are handrails on both sides, which are within reach.
- The handrails are easy to grip.
- The handrails cover the flight of stairs throughout its length.
- The handrails extend horizontally beyond the first and last step.
- The steps are clearly marked.
- The height of the steps is between 15cm and 18cm.
- The height of the highest step is 17cm.
- The depth of the steps is between 30cm-45cm.
- Lighting levels vary due to the use of large glazed walls.
Toilet with Adaptations (Floor 0 - J017 - Right Hand Transfer)
-
Location
View
- The toilet surveyed is located along the corridor to the right of the building on floor 0.
- The distance from the entrance is 35m.
-
Route
View
- The most accessible route to the toilet has step-free level access.
- There are no doors to open along the most accessible route.
-
Access
View
- There is step-free level access into the facility.
- There is tactile, pictorial, written text and numbered signage on or near the door.
- The door opens outwards and has a high colour contrast.
- The width of the opening is 90cm.
- The door has a lever twist lock.
- Internally the door has a high colour contrast.
- There is a grab rail on the internal door, with a medium colour contrast.
-
Dimensions and Features
View
- The dimensions of the cubicle are 155cm (width) x 220cm (depth).
- There is room for a wheelchair user to manoeuvre.
- There is a lateral transfer space to the right as you face the toilet, however it is obstructed.
- The lateral transfer space is 85cm (from the side of the toilet pan).
- There is a push button flush for the toilet.
- The flush is on the wall above the cistern.
- There is a horizontal grab rail on the non-transfer side.
- The horizontal grab rail has a medium colour contrast.
- There is a vertical grab rail on the transfer side.
- The vertical grab rail has a medium colour contrast.
- There is a dropdown grab rail on the transfer side.
- The dropdown grab rail has a high colour contrast.
- The toilet seat is 48cm from the floor.
- The toilet seat has a low colour contrast.
- The toilet has a padded backrest.
- The toilet roll holder cannot be reached when seated on the toilet.
- The toilet roll holder has a high colour contrast.
- The toilet roll holder is 88cm from the floor.
- The wash basin has a lever mixer tap.
- The wash basin and tap can be reached when seated on the toilet.
- The wash basin is 74cm from the floor.
- There are vertical grab rails on both sides of the wash basin.
- The wash basin grab rails have a medium colour contrast.
- There is a wall mounted soap dispenser.
- The soap dispenser cannot be reached when seated on the toilet.
- The soap dispenser has a high colour contrast.
- The soap dispenser is 95cm from the floor.
- There is not a towel dispenser.
- There is a wall mounted hand dryer.
- The hand dryer has a high colour contrast.
- The hand dryer is 95cm from the floor.
- There is a pull cord emergency alarm within 10cm from the floor.
- There is a mirror.
- There is no shelf.
- The cubicle has a sanitary bin.
- There are no coat hooks.
- The walls and floor have a high colour contrast.
- Lighting levels were even at the time of the survey.
